summaryrefslogtreecommitdiff
path: root/firmware/export/si4700.h
diff options
context:
space:
mode:
Diffstat (limited to 'firmware/export/si4700.h')
-rw-r--r--firmware/export/si4700.h12
1 files changed, 12 insertions, 0 deletions
diff --git a/firmware/export/si4700.h b/firmware/export/si4700.h
index a740ae03ab..5b8001f753 100644
--- a/firmware/export/si4700.h
+++ b/firmware/export/si4700.h
@@ -25,6 +25,18 @@
25#ifndef _SI4700_H_ 25#ifndef _SI4700_H_
26#define _SI4700_H_ 26#define _SI4700_H_
27 27
28#define HAVE_RADIO_REGION
29
30struct si4700_region_data
31{
32 unsigned char deemphasis; /* 0: 50us, 1: 75us */
33 unsigned char band; /* 0: us/europe, 1: japan */
34 unsigned char spacing; /* 0: us/australia (200kHz), 1: europe/japan (100kHz), 2: (50kHz) */
35} __attribute__((packed));
36
37extern const struct si4700_region_data si4700_region_data[TUNER_NUM_REGIONS];
38
39void si4700_init(void);
28int si4700_set(int setting, int value); 40int si4700_set(int setting, int value);
29int si4700_get(int setting); 41int si4700_get(int setting);
30 42